Quantum Gravity Boundary Terms from Spectral Action of Noncommutative Space

1 Pith paper cite this work. Polarity classification is still indexing.

1 Pith paper citing it
abstract

We study the boundary terms of the spectral action of the noncommutative space, defined by the spectral triple dictated by the physical spectrum of the standard model, unifying gravity with all other fundamental interactions. We prove that the spectral action predicts uniquely the gravitational boundary term required for consistency of quantum gravity with the correct sign and coefficient. This is a remarkable result given the lack of freedom in the spectral action to tune this term.
